What is a Buisness Mobile?
A buisness mobile refers to a mobile phone or smartphone designed specifically for use in a professional environment. These devices come equipped with features and functionalities that cater to the needs of employees, teams, and entire organizations. This includes enhanced security measures, efficient communication tools, productivity applications, and seamless integration with existing IT infrastructures. By leveraging a buisness mobile, companies can enhance employee productivity, facilitate remote work, and ensure secure communications.
Key Features of Buisness Mobile Devices
Buisness mobile devices boast a range of features that make them ideal for corporate use. Some of the key features include:
- Advanced Security: Buisness mobiles often come with built-in security protocols like VPN support, biometric authentication, and device encryption to protect sensitive data.
- Productivity Applications: These devices usually support a variety of business applications, from project management tools to communication platforms.
- Enhanced Connectivity: With functionalities such as 5G compatibility and VoIP, buisness mobiles ensure reliable communication at all times.
- Enterprise Integration: Many buisness mobiles provide seamless integration with enterprise systems like CRM software, email, and other business tools.
- Long Battery Life: Designed for all-day use, these devices often have extended battery performance to support active users.

Choosing the Right Buisness Mobile for Your Needs
Assessing Your Business Requirements
To select the most suitable buisness mobile, it’s crucial to assess your company’s specific needs. Start by identifying the primary use cases for the devices—will they be used for heavy email processing, video conferencing, or perhaps fieldwork? Consider the following factors:
- Employee Roles: Different roles may require different functionalities. Sales teams might need devices with excellent camera quality for client presentations, while office personnel may prioritize communication features.
- Budget: Factor in the total cost of ownership, including device acquisition, data plans, and management expenses.
- Security Needs: Determine how sensitive the data being handled is. More secure environments may require devices with advanced encryption features.

Implementing Buisness Mobile Solutions
Steps to Integrate Buisness Mobile into Your Operations
Successfully integrating buisness mobile solutions requires a strategic approach. Here’s a step-by-step guide:
- Define Objectives: Clarify what goals you aim to achieve with the implementation of buisness mobile devices. This could include improving team productivity or enhancing client communication.
- Plan Deployment: Develop a comprehensive plan that includes timelines, budget, and resource allocation for the rollout of mobile devices.
- Implement Security Measures: Establish security protocols to protect sensitive information. This could involve device management systems that enforce security policies.
- Distribute Devices: Hand out the devices along with a clear explanation of their features and intended use.
- Monitor Performance: Keep track of how the devices perform in the field and gather feedback from users to refine operations continually.

Apps and Tools to Enhance Buisness Mobile Functionality
Utilizing the right applications on buisness mobiles can significantly enhance productivity. Popular categories to consider include:
- Project Management: Apps such as Trello or Asana can help in tracking projects and deadlines.
- Communication Tools: Platforms like Slack or Microsoft Teams can improve team collaboration, allowing for real-time communication.
- Document Management: Cloud-based solutions such as Google Drive or Dropbox facilitate document sharing and collaborative editing features.

Impact of 5G on Buisness Mobile Experience
The rollout of 5G technology promises faster data speeds, lower latency, and improved connectivity. This shift can revolutionize how organizations interact with mobile devices, enabling:
- Seamless video conferencing with high-definition video quality.
- Enhanced cloud-based applications that operate in real-time without lag.
- The expansion of IoT capabilities, allowing for improved device integration.
